Malta - Indigenous Rabbit Meat Gross Production
Since 2014, Malta Indigenous Rabbit Meat Gross Production fell by 3.5% year on year. With $11.16 Million in 2019, the country was ranked number 17 among other countries in Indigenous Rabbit Meat Gross Production. Malta is overtaken by Kenya, which was ranked number 16 with $13.52 Million and is followed by Kazakhstan at $8.64 Million. Venezuela lead the ranking with $3,599.23 Million in 2014, +20% compared to 2013. China, Italy and Egypt resp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Uruguay recorded the best 5 years average growth at +31.4% per year, while Germany was the worst growing country at -37.9% per year.
